    Ethel Mary Allen - "Our community was saddened Saturday morning on learning of the death of Miss Ethel Allen, which occurred during the night at her home in Burke Center. Ethel was a beautiful young lady, loved by all who knew her, the youngest daughter of Mr. & Mrs. Wilbur Allen. She was a graduate of Franklin Academy, year 1910, and from the training class in 1911, after which she taught school three years, then entered the Albany Hospital, where she was studying to be a trained nurse. She won many friends wherever she went by her sunny disposition and pleasing manner. At Christmas time she came home for her holidays and was not feeling well. She had been nursing a Typhoid Fever patient for several weeks and in her weak condition contracted the disease. All that loving hands and skillful care could do was done for her but no avail and her bright young life went out Friday night. The sympathy of the entire community is extended to the bereaved family. Ethel was a member of the Presbyterian Church and a worker in all its different branches, where she will be greatly missed. She is survived by her parents, three brothers, John, Kenneth, and Leslie of Toronto, Canada and two sisters Anna of Burke, and Mrs. Wilson of Bradford, Vt. The funeral was held on Monday from the Presbyterian Church, Rev. J. Bamford, Officiating."

    - Obituary from the Malone Farmer.
